GNU projekto sukurtos GNU Taler 0.10 mokėjimo sistemos išleidimas

После полутора лет разработки проект GNU представил выпуск свободной системы электронных платежей GNU Taler 0.10, предоставляющей анонимность покупателям, но сохраняющей возможность идентификации продавцов для обеспечения прозрачности предоставления налоговой отчётности. Система не позволяет отследить информацию о том, куда пользователь тратит деньги, но предоставляет средства для отслеживания поступления средств (отправитель остаётся анонимным), что решает свойственные BitCoin проблемы с налоговым аудитом. Код написан на Python и распространяется под лицензиями AGPLv3 и LGPLv3.

GNU Taler nekuria savo kriptovaliutos, bet dirba su esamomis valiutomis, įskaitant dolerius, eurus ir bitkoinus. Parama naujoms valiutoms gali būti teikiama sukūrus banką, kuris veiktų kaip finansinis garantas. GNU Taler verslo modelis paremtas keitimo operacijų atlikimu – pinigai iš tradicinių mokėjimo sistemų, tokių kaip BitCoin, Mastercard, SEPA, Visa, ACH ir SWIFT, konvertuojami į anoniminius elektroninius pinigus ta pačia valiuta. Vartotojas gali pervesti elektroninius pinigus prekybininkams, kurie keitimo punkte gali juos iškeisti atgal į tikrus pinigus, kuriuos atstovauja tradicinės mokėjimo sistemos.

Visos GNU Taler operacijos yra apsaugotos naudojant moderniausius kriptografinius algoritmus, kad būtų užtikrintas autentiškumas, net jei nutekėtų klientų, prekybininkų ir biržų privatūs raktai. Duomenų bazės formatas suteikia galimybę patikrinti visas atliktas operacijas ir patvirtinti jų nuoseklumą. Mokėjimo patvirtinimas prekybininkams yra kriptografinis pavedimo įrodymas pagal su klientu sudarytą sutartį ir kriptografiškai pasirašytas patvirtinimas, kad keitimo punkte yra lėšų. GNU Taler apima pagrindinių komponentų rinkinį, kuris suteikia banko, keitimo punkto, prekybos platformos, piniginės ir auditoriaus veikimo logiką.

Финансирование разработки осуществляется на гранты Еврокомиссии, Государственного секретариата Швейцарии по образованию и Государственного секретариата Швейцарии по исследованиям и инновациям (SERI). В рамках проекта NGI TALER ведётся работа по созданию на базе GNU Taler продукта, готового для применения в Евросоюзе.

Pagrindiniai pakeitimai:

  • Добавлена поддержка обмена ключами с использованием протокола EBICS 3.0 (Electronic Banking Internet Communication Standard), предназначенного для защищённого обмена информацией о платежах между банками. Для отправки запросов в банки с использованием протокола EBICS предложена утилита libeufin-nexus.
  • Для магазинов предложен более удобный интерфейс проведения платежей с использованием QR-кодов, реализованный через публично доступный обработчик GET-запросов, использующий шаблоны.
  • В Apple app store размещена реализация кошелька для платформы iOS.
  • В кошельках улучшено управление подключением к точкам обмена.
  • В Wallet-core добавлена возможность генерации событий мониторинга для упрощения диагностики.
  • Для кошельков реализован новый тип транзакций, представляющих средства, потерянные из-за деноминации, отзыва или истечения срока действия монет.
  • В Wallet-core обеспечено кэширование запросов и добавлена поддержка верификации ключей в асинхронном режиме.

Šaltinis: opennet.ru

Добавить комментарий